Highland Park Community Foundation
The Highland Park Community Foundation is a public charity and community foundation established in 1992 at the request of the City of Highland Park to build and maintain a permanent endowment fund. Based in Highland Park, Illinois, the Foundation serves Highland Park and Highwood residents by supporting social service, cultural, educational, and environmental agencies in the region.

Mission & Focus Areas
Mission: To address the unmet needs of our community and expand opportunities for all Highland Park and Highwood residents.
The Foundation focuses on supporting agencies and programs in the following areas:
- Social services
- Cultural programs
- Educational initiatives
- Environmental programs
- Youth support and counseling
- Early childhood programs
- College readiness assistance
- Senior services
- Programs for individuals with disabilities
- Affordable legal services
- Food access initiatives
The Foundation prioritizes addressing community needs not met by governmental or other sources and nurtures the early stages of new and innovative programs.
